About UPM

UPM-Kymmene Oyj, founded in 1996 via merger in Finland, is a leading global material solutions company with approximately 15,800 employes and its headquarters in Helsinki. UPM BioMotion™ Renewable Functional Fillers (RFF)—produced at the Leuna biorefinery—offer an eco-friendly alternative to fossil-based fillers like carbon black and silica. Derived from sustainably sourced hardwood, these fillers help reduce CO₂ emissions, lower product weight, and enhance performance across elastomers and thermoplastic systems.

UPM Biofibrils

UPM Biofibrils by UPM is a collection of isolated cellulose fibrils, or fibril bundles, obtained from natural wood-based pulp. Acts as a rheology modifier. The small dimensions of UPM Biofibrils lead to a high specific surface area and a strong interaction with water. This gives a very special type of rheology characterized by a high stabilizing effect in combination with viscosity reducing behavior and an increased shear rate. The two main functions of UPM Biofibrils, namely the rheology modifier as well as reinforced fiber, offer a range of possibilities for shaping materials and giving them new characteristics. Through its rheology controlling functions the product can improve the stability of suspensions with low dosage and save costs. UPM Biofibrils also has remarkably good gas barrier properties, which can bring added value to coatings.
